  • Patent number: 9370387
    Abstract: A bone plate system for reshaping a bone plate to conform to contours of bone surfaces. The system comprises a bone plate, a pair of spaced-apart guides removably attached to the bone plate, and a bending tool. The bending tool comprises a handle and a head attached to a distal end of the handle. The head defines a cavity sized and shaped to engage the pair of spaced-apart guides. The bone plate system is configured to transfer a leverage force applied by a user to the bending tool while the cavity of the head is fitted over the pair of spaced-apart guides to a regionalized bending moment to the bone plate through the pair of spaced-apart guides to reshape the bone plate.

  • Patent number: 6820345
    Abstract: A combination carpenter square and bevel/sliding bevel having three triangle-shaped adjoining legs, with an articulating joint between the hypotenuse leg and each adjoining leg. The other two non-hypotenuse legs are capable of forming a substantially 90 degree angle between the two non-hypotenuse legs to function as a carpenter's square. At least one of the articulating joints at the hypotenuse leg is capable of tightening and loosening. The hypotenuse leg also consists of a slot positioned longitudinally of the hypotenuse leg. The tightening and loosening articulated joint joins the hypotenuse leg with an adjacent non-hypotenuse leg through the slot, which allows the adjacent non-hypotenuse leg movement about the joint relative to the hypotenuse leg to function as a bevel. The articulated joints allow the combination square and bevel/sliding bevel to be folded into a compact shape.

  • Patent number: 6662460
    Abstract: A combination carpenter square and bevel/sliding bevel having three triangle-shaped adjoining legs, with an articulating joint between the hypotenuse leg and each adjoining leg. The other two non-hypotenuse legs are capable of being latched or detached by a latching joint that, when latched, forms a substantially 90 degree angle between the two non-hypotenuse legs to function as a carpenter's square. One of the articulating joints at the hypotenuse leg is capable of tightening and loosening. The hypotenuse leg also consists of a slot positioned longitudinally of the hypotenuse leg. The tightening and loosening articulated joint joins the hypotenuse leg with an adjacent leg through the slot, which allows the adjacent leg movement about the joint relative to the hypotenuse leg to function as a bevel. The articulated joints and the detaching function of the latching joint allows the combination square and bevel/sliding bevel to be folded into a compact shape.

  • Patent number: 5974677
    Abstract: The layout instrument or tool of this invention includes a pair of members arranged together to form an "L" at a right angle. The unique feature of this arrangement is that the two opposing ends of the "L" are also affixed to another member changing the shape from an "L" to the shape of a 3-4-5 triangle. All members of the instrument are permanently attached, therefore, misalignment is avoided and accuracy is assured and maintained. The two members are configured to slide with respect to one another at the pivot point of the "L" and simply pivot at their opposite ends about their pivot points connecting the third member and creating an enclosed triangle. A spring loaded rivet mounted in one of "L" members slides in a skewed slot in the adjacent member to open the triangle from a closed position where the three sides or members of the triangle are substantially parallel to one another.
